Back in 2018, when the landwas FIRST acquired, there was only a water spigot and a 14x14 structure that was basically a glorified shed... Now we refer to it as the Gallery Cabin. Its slowly gaining local art work pieces for display and purchasing... Now, ears later, we have created many fun spaces and built many structures for our many hobbies and passions. We have built a small workshop, a rock cutting/shaping/soil mixing area, Shipping Container workshop and decked out a shed with a work station and a long marble counter top. We have built a 3-level tree fort with a crow's nest and a 10x12 screened Bungalow in the woods. This is a great spot to have less chance of bugs at night, still have electricity for Lights and phone charging. We have also created a large garden with 9 beds, using various aspects of Permaculture, including several Hugelculture beds. We created a comfortable and private outside shower in the upper corner of the garden, that is perfect after a long day of having our hands in the soil! (Named the "Flower Shower" as we grow various seasonal flowers, Sage and some beautiful Poppies that can be seen from the shower.) It's now equipped with Propane heat for optional warm showers year long. Because this is Arkansas, and we live at the top of a ridge, our topsoil is mainly clay and rocks... so one of the first endeavors we started was creating a 5 bin mass composting system to build up our soil for our gardens. We found grocery stores and coffee shops to donate hundreds of pounds of old produce and coffee grounds. Since our arrival we have made over 6000+ lbs of beautiful compost and continue to do so today! We are a pet friendly place. We also get rare bookings being a SnifSpot ( Dog Park) But all dogs must be leashed or proven ( caretaker onsite approval) of being off leash trained. The only Exception is Miguel-dog. He has been on the property with us for 3+ years. Very gentle and calm. He usually needs to greet you, then you can be free. He can be separated if need. (Aggressive dogs are NOT allowed. Thanks.) We have a resident, neutered male cat named, Hikari aka "Ari." He is dog friendly. However if your dog chases cats, please keep your dog leashed. We have planted 10 fruit and nut trees and started a 'Berry Orchard'. We also have a small vineyard consisting of about 15 trained Muscadine vines. Closer to the house is a wonderful Herb Spiral that showcases of up to 20 medicinal and cooking herbs and we have a dozen more herbs in the other garden and around our land as well. We also have been planting a food forest outside the garden area, growing PawPaw trees, Gooseberries, Jerusalem Artichokes and Opossum grapes for the critters... so they may leave our actual garden alone, but they can still come close to get a tasty snack. We also built a large chicken coop for 4 egg layer chickens, 4 ducks and 3 guineas that free range our yard during the day. Our numbers vary year to year. There is over a mile plus of trails through our woods, criss-crossing over our seasonal springs that we have built bridges over. Our trails go up and down the mossy topped valleys and ridges with many places to comfortably stop and rest along the way. One aspect about all this that we are extremely proud of, is that we have built 75% or more out of RECLAIMED MATERIALS and RECLAIMED LUMBER (and made it look good!) -- Learn more about this land: -- We are located only 12 miles from I-40, just north of Vilonia. Our Homestead Farm: Barefoot Gardens, is on 8 acres of hardwood forest, where we use various Permaculture techniques to grow over 140+ varieties of various herbs, fruits, vegetables, trees and flowers! 60 acres of bench, hill woodland. Our land is primarily wooded but we are slowly expanding with a variety of fruit trees and berries that are disease tolerant in this bioregion. There is parking space bordering Hwy 16. Summer Berry Farm is two miles from Tilly Arkansas as you are headed towards Witt Springs. We have a small remote A frame for camping as well as a platform for tent camping. We are working on the interior of a small 3 bedroom cabin both a log construction and a earthen clay straw mixture, called daub, covered with local lime plaster. For those who would like to tend a few chickens we can arrange to have chickens near your camping area. We are also working on bicycle/walking trails through some of our rugged areas. Our property corners with 80 acres of bureau of land management land that is a rugged ravine with a stream running through the lower area, the head waters of Bear creek. The A frame is off by itself on our back 40 and requires four wheel drive for access in the winter season.

Located in Paron, AR, our Paron Private Paradise RV Space (and our home) sits on two beautiful woodland acres. The property is bordered on three sides by the Ouachita National Forest and the Winona Wildlife Management Area (WMA). Lake Winona is just 2.6 miles away and does not offer RV camping — you won’t find anything closer to the lake to park your RV! We’re your one-stop spot for hunting and fishing enthusiasts, hikers, bikers, and side-by-side or four-wheeler adventurers. The Ouachita National Forest offers hundreds of miles of nearby trails, and we’re the gateway to several surrounding National Parks within 30 miles. The graveled RV space, shaded by a 200-plus-year-old white oak tree, offers generous room for your RV or motorhome, slide-outs, one vehicle, side-by-side or four-wheeler, and bikes. Hunters and all guests have direct access from the property into the Winona Wildlife Management Area, home to deer, turkey, squirrels, and the occasional wild hog or black bear. Lake Winona — a designated protected water source surrounded by the National Forest — offers a dam, park area, hiking and biking trails, fishing, and a secluded boat launch for small fishing boats. Swimming, water skiing, and jet skis are not allowed. For swimming and water sports, Lake Sylvia (16 miles away) is a great alternative. RV amenities include: • Full hookups (50-amp electric, water, and septic) • A quartz rock-bordered grassy garden with a 100-year-old outdoor fireplace • Wi-Fi access at the fireplace • Outdoor deck and dining area • Security light at the top of the driveway adjacent to the RV pad The grassy garden area also serves as a privacy buffer between the RV space and our home. Please note: we do not offer septic dumping privileges due to septic size limitations. Nearby amenities: • Public ice station in Paron (7 miles) • Williams Junction Convenience Store and fuel (15 miles) • Pinnacle Mountain State Park (21 miles) • Petit Jean State Park (24 miles) • Hot Springs, Lake Catherine, Lake Hamilton, and Lake Ouachita — all within 30 miles Rules & Policies: • Adults only (must be 21+) • No smoking • No public intoxication • Pet-friendly: Pets must be on a leash while outdoors and approved before booking
